Mounded Storage Vessels (MSV) are commonly used in industries such as petrochemicals, liquefied Petroleum gas (LPG), and chemical processing, where the containment of hazardous materials is critical. However, the stability and integrity of these structures depend significantly on the adequacy of their foundation systems, particularly when constructed on weak soil deposits. This paper presents a comprehensive study of the performance of vibro stone columns employed as ground improvement technique for foundations of mounded storage vessels situated on weak soil deposits. This study employs geotechnical analyses for foundation designs and their performance under different loading scenarios. The case studies cover the effectiveness of vibro stone columns in enhancing the stability of mounded storage vessel foundations at various locations. The findings of this study provide valuable insights for practicing engineers involved in the design and construction of MSVs, enabling them to take decisions to ensure the safety, reliability, and longevity of these critical industrial structures.
